Over the past few years, the way we work has immeasurably changed. What was considered a temporary solution to a challenging time became the new normal, and the hybrid workforce became an inherent part of today’s business climate.

So, how are companies responding to this changing workforce? According to a report by Microsoft, many leaders yearn for a return to what once was an office filled with staff. While 87% of employees surveyed said they felt productive, about 85% of leaders were less confident about their hybrid staff’s productivity. Yet, today, people expect autonomy and flexibility around where and when they work. 

How do businesses bridge the gap and ensure a productive and collaborative workforce? The answer is the growing collaboration space that enables employees to work together, whether in the office or halfway around the world. For this space to work, you need the right systems and technologies in place.
